What Is Vitamin B-12?
Vitamin B-12 (cobalamin) is a water-soluble vitamin that your body cannot produce on its own — it must come from food or supplementation. It plays a central role in three critical areas:
Nerve Function
B-12 is essential for maintaining the myelin sheath — the protective coating around nerve fibers. Without adequate B-12, nerve signals slow down or become disrupted, which can manifest as tingling, numbness, or cognitive changes over time.
DNA Synthesis
Every time your cells divide, they need to replicate DNA. B-12 is a required cofactor in this process, making it especially important for rapidly dividing cells like red blood cells and the cells lining your digestive tract.
Red Blood Cell Formation
B-12 works alongside folate to produce healthy, properly sized red blood cells. Without it, red blood cells can become abnormally large and dysfunctional — a condition known as megaloblastic anemia — reducing the blood's ability to carry oxygen efficiently.
What Is Folate (Vitamin B-9)?
Folate is the naturally occurring form of Vitamin B-9, found in foods like leafy greens, legumes, and citrus. Folic acid is the synthetic form used in many supplements and fortified foods — though the body must convert it to its active form (methylfolate) before it can be used.
Folate is critical for:
- Cell division and growth — particularly important during pregnancy for fetal neural tube development
- DNA repair and methylation — a process that regulates gene expression and detoxification
- Homocysteine metabolism — working with B-12 to convert homocysteine (an amino acid linked to cardiovascular risk at elevated levels) into beneficial compounds
Why B-12 and Folate Work Better Together
B-12 and folate are deeply interdependent. They share a metabolic pathway called the methylation cycle, which is responsible for converting homocysteine into methionine — an amino acid used to build proteins and support brain chemistry.
When either nutrient is deficient, this cycle stalls. Homocysteine accumulates, which has been associated with increased risk of cardiovascular disease, cognitive decline, and mood imbalances. Supplementing both together ensures the cycle runs efficiently.
Additionally, high-dose folate supplementation can mask a B-12 deficiency by correcting the blood abnormalities it causes — while the underlying nerve damage continues undetected. This is one reason why a combined formula is often preferable to taking folate alone.
Key Benefits of the B-12 & Folate Combination
Energy Metabolism
B-12 is involved in converting food into usable cellular energy. Fatigue is one of the earliest and most common signs of B-12 deficiency — not because B-12 is a stimulant, but because without it, your cells can't produce energy efficiently.
Cognitive Clarity & Mood Support
Both B-12 and folate are required for the synthesis of neurotransmitters including serotonin, dopamine, and norepinephrine. Low levels of either have been associated with brain fog, low mood, and age-related cognitive decline.
Cardiovascular Health
By supporting healthy homocysteine metabolism, B-12 and folate together contribute to cardiovascular wellness — particularly important for those with a family history of heart disease or elevated homocysteine levels.
Healthy Pregnancy
Folate is one of the most well-established prenatal nutrients, critical for preventing neural tube defects in early fetal development. B-12 supports this process and is equally important for maternal energy and neurological health.
Who May Be Deficient?
B-12 deficiency is more common than many people realize. Groups at elevated risk include:
- Vegans and vegetarians — B-12 is found almost exclusively in animal products; plant-based eaters must supplement
- Adults over 50 — Stomach acid production declines with age, reducing the body's ability to absorb B-12 from food
- Those with digestive conditions — Crohn's disease, celiac disease, and atrophic gastritis can impair B-12 absorption
- People taking certain medications — Metformin (for diabetes) and proton pump inhibitors (for acid reflux) are known to deplete B-12 over time
- Those with MTHFR gene variants — A common genetic variation that impairs the conversion of folic acid to active methylfolate, making methylfolate supplementation preferable
How to Choose a Quality B-12 & Folate Supplement
Not all B-12 and folate supplements are created equal. Here's what to look for:
Form of B-12:
- Methylcobalamin — the active, bioavailable form; preferred for most people, especially those with absorption issues
- Cyanocobalamin — a synthetic form that must be converted; less expensive but less bioavailable for some individuals
Form of Folate:
- Methylfolate (5-MTHF) — the active form; bypasses the conversion step and is especially important for those with MTHFR variants
- Folic acid — the synthetic form; requires conversion and may not be efficiently processed by everyone
Dosage transparency: Look for supplements that clearly list the form and amount of each nutrient, not just a proprietary blend.

Signs You May Need More B-12 or Folate
Common signs of deficiency include:
- Persistent fatigue or low energy despite adequate sleep
- Brain fog, difficulty concentrating, or memory lapses
- Tingling or numbness in hands or feet
- Mood changes, irritability, or low mood
- Pale or yellowish skin
- Shortness of breath or heart palpitations
- Mouth sores or a swollen, inflamed tongue
If you experience several of these symptoms, speak with your healthcare provider about testing your B-12 and folate levels.
Getting Enough Through Diet
The best dietary sources of B-12 include:
- Clams, oysters, and mussels (among the highest concentrations)
- Beef liver and organ meats
- Salmon, tuna, and sardines
- Eggs and dairy products
For folate, focus on:
- Dark leafy greens (spinach, romaine, arugula)
- Lentils, chickpeas, and black beans
- Asparagus and broccoli
- Avocado and citrus fruits
For many people — especially those following plant-based diets or over age 50 — diet alone may not be sufficient to maintain optimal levels, making supplementation a practical and important tool.
